PALMER – Sure, you can get a bacon, lettuce and tomato (BLT) sandwich just about anywhere, but if you are looking for the best one, Angel’s 1376 Restaurant in Palmer, is the place to go.

Following Reminder Publishing’s recent expansion to Palmer, I have heard remarkable reviews about Angel’s Restaurant from residents and business owners in town. To find out for myself what all the talk is about, I took to their website to see what their menu consists of.

With a variety of sandwiches to choose from, one in particular caught my eye – my all-time favorite – a classic BLT.

Described on the menu as, “Crispy strips of our thick cut Applewood smoked bacon, beefsteak tomato slices, hearty green leaf and mayo piled high on your choice of toasted bread,” the summary was exactly what I received.

You might be wondering, ‘How can someone mess up a BLT?’ In my opinion, it’s easy. The bacon either makes or breaks the overall sandwich. In this case, the savory bacon was cooked to perfection. Surrounded by equal layers of lettuce and tomato, the three key ingredients were well balanced throughout.

The wheat bread holding the sandwich together was lightly toasted, making for the perfect crunch. Hints of mayonnaise were layered within, which also balanced well between the meat and vegetables.

From the first bite to last, the BLT was crowded with flavor. The fresh ingredients used to create this lunch left me feeling pleasantly full, but not stuffed – all for a reasonable price.

Forget those average BLT’s. If you want an authentic, delicious BLT that will leave you wanting more, visit Angel’s, at 1376 Main St. in Palmer.
